The Roads and Transport Authority(RTA), initiated in 2006, helps regulate the transportation and reduce the traffic congestions within the city. It not only regulates road traffic but also manages the metro system of the area.
With a wide array of flyovers, underpasses and bridges, the road system of Dubai is well regulated and maintained. The roads are wide and hardly ever witness major bottlenecks except on some routes such as the Duai-Sharjah route which the RTA claims to solve soon. However, traffic congestion still remains the biggest concern of Dubai due to its ever increasing population. Nonetheless, the citizens have a choice between keeping privately owned cars or getting a taxi. There are both governed run taxis as well as private companies that run taxis around the city and are easily available at many tax stands. People also have the choice of riding the bus. The Bus routes are clearly defined and can be found online as well. They are also very effective and efficient since they are always on time and do not cater to any kinds of delays.
